ibm bluemix€¦ · focus on your apps and their data. timing is critical… ~ weeks ibm bluemix ~...
TRANSCRIPT
Bluemix ayuda a Transformar ideas en proyectos
Cualquier proyecto comienza con una línea de código
Interesante lectura sobre el origen del PaaS:
http://cdn.oreillystatic.com/oreilly/booksamplers/9781449334901_sampler.pdf
App development is about speed and choice
Succeed 1st
or Fail
Fast
Seconds to
Deploy Friction
Free
Any
Language
Continuous
Integration
Mobile
Ready
Focus on
Code
Choice of
Tools
Useful
APIs
Developers’ expectations have evolved.
4
Core
IT
Today’s apps must keep up with the speed of the app revolution.
Timing is critical…
5
Benefits
Fully customizable.
Few limitations.
Necessary for some solutions.
Existing Investments.
Time Commitment
Weeks to setup and deploy.
Maintenance/upgrades of
hardware and software.
~ Weeks ~ Days
Code
Data
Runtime
Middleware
OS
Virtualization
Servers
Storage
Networking
~ Minutes
Time to initial deployment
Customer Managed
6
Benefits
Most control in the cloud.
Necessary for some solutions.
Infrastructure managed by SP.
Infrastructure
as a ServiceCustomer Managed
Service Provider Managed
~ Days
Time Commitment
Minutes to provision VM.
Time to configure software
and apps varies.
Maintenance/upgrades of OS,
middleware, runtime.
IBM SoftLayer
Timing is critical…
~ Minutes
Code
Data
Runtime
Middleware
OS
Virtualization
Servers
Storage
Networking
~ Weeks
Core IT
Today’s apps must keep up with the speed of the app revolution.
Time to initial deployment
7
~ Minutes
Platform
as a ServiceCustomer Managed
Service Provider Managed
IaaS
Benefits
Setup environments and
deploy apps very quickly.
Infrastructure and platform
managed by SP.
Time Commitment
Minutes to setup and deploy.
Focus on your apps and their
data.
Timing is critical…
~ Weeks
IBM Bluemix
~ Days
Time to initial deployment
Code
Data
Runtime
Middleware
OS
Virtualization
Servers
Storage
Networking
Core IT
Today’s apps must keep up with the speed of the app revolution.
8
IaaS PaaS
…so are all of your other investmentsLeverage the power of Bluemix without abandoning what you already use.
Core IT
IBM Bluemix
What is Bluemix?
10
Bluemix is an open-standard, cloud-based platform for
building, managing, and running applications of all types
(web, mobile, big data, new smart devices, and so on).
Go Live in Seconds
The developer can choose
any language runtime or
bring their own. Zero to
production in one command.
DevOps
Development, monitoring,
deployment, and logging tools
allow the developer to run the
entire application.
APIs and Services
A catalog of IBM, third party,
and open source API services
allow the developer to stitch an
application together in minutes.
On-Prem Integration
Build hybrid environments.
Connect to on-premise assets
plus other public and private
clouds.
Flexible Pricing
Sign up in minutes. Pay as
you go and subscription
models offer choice and
flexibility.
Layered Security
IBM secures the platform and
infrastructure and provides
you with the tools to secure
your apps.
How does Bluemix work?Bluemix embraces Cloud Foundry as an open source Platform as a
Service and extends it with IBM, third party, and community built services.
11
Why are developers using Bluemix?
12
Go from zero to running
code in a matter of
minutes.
Automate the development
and delivery of many
applications.
To rapidly bring
products and services to
market at lower cost
To continuously deliver
new functionality to their
applications
To extend existing
investments in IT
infrastructure
Extend existing investments by
connecting securely to on-premise
infrastructure.
Run your apps in seconds
14
• Provision runtimes in seconds
No VM or middleware setup
• Auto and manual scaling options
Multiple language support
• Java Liberty, JavaScript, and
Ruby provided
• Bring any language from the
community
Zero to production in one command. Setup made simple.
Pick your own development tooling
15
IBM provided (hub.jazz.net)Fully integrated repository and web
editor to deploy directly to Bluemix.
Use your ownUse your editor (e.g. Sublime,
Eclipse) and deploy through the
Cloud Foundry command line.
Code wherever you work best. Deploy in seconds.
Create apps quickly with prebuilt services
16
• Runtimes, services, and tooling
up to you
Choice
Industry Leading IBM Capabilities• Services leveraging the depth
of IBM software
• Full range of capabilities
Completeness
• Open source platform and services
• Third party to enable key use cases
Security
Services
Web and
application
services
Cloud
Integration
Services
Mobile
Services
Database
services
Big Data
services
Internet of
Things
Services
Watson
Services
DevOps
Services
A full range of capabilities to suit any great idea.
Fully integrated environment for deploying and managing your application
Single DashboardSingle view of application health,
usage and status
Health and MonitoringIntegrated monitoring and
diagnostics with the ability to add
on features such as code level
tracing
ScalingAbility to scale the application by
adding new runtime instances
Application Management
19
Security connect to and leverage data from your existing systems
Cast Iron Integration
DataMapper
API Management
SecureConnector
Private API Catalog
Integrate Into Existing Applications
This API provides access to on-premise data,
specifically a lookup of the address where a
customer purchase was made.
22
Public cloud is just the beginning for BluemixIntroducing “Borderless Bluemix”
SharedOff-Premises
Cloud
DedicatedOn-Premises
Cloud
Traditional IT Dedicated
Off-Premises Cloud
• Expertise – Extensive experience across segments and in enterprise integration
• Open Integration – Connection across clouds
• Control – Decide where individual application components reside
Enterprise Applications
Cloud Enabled
Cloud Native Apps/Services
Hybrid Cloud
Cloud Foundry components delivered
on-prem along with selected, foundational
services.
Bluemix delivered within your own private
SoftLayer VLAN.
Integration with traditional IT will
be built across all Bluemix delivery
models.
Composed of IBM, 3rd
party and open source services.
Q4 2014 Q1 2015
23
Una experiencia híbrida continua
24
•Un experiencia única de catalogo
• Construir y desplegar aplicaciones usando una combinación de servicios públicos y dedicados
•Consola de Operaciones Bluemix
• Seguridad y registros de auditoria
• Gestión de usuarios y grupos con soporte de LDAP
• Información de uso y disponibilidad del sistema en tiempo real (*)
• Planificación automática de actualizaciones (*)
• Capacidad de visualizar estado y uso de los servicios y entornos de ejecución en el catalogo (*)
Que significa
Independientemente de si sus aplicaciones y servicios están en Bluemix
Publico, Dedicado, o Local, puede esperar una experiencia híbrida, única y
portable
Coming Summer 2015
(*) Estos servicios serán desplegados en los próximos meses dentro del proceso de entrega continua
Sign up in minutes. Pay for what you use.
26
Cloud based pricing models to serve developer needs
• 30 day trial - designed to allow testing
of an entire application on the platform
Friction free adoption
• Free tier for every service -
encourages experimentation of new
services for applications already
running on Bluemix
• Pay as you go - optimized for
flexibility, no term commitment
Multiple Commitment Models
• Subscription - term based optimized
for cost, discounted from pay as you
go rates
• Zero to coding in less than 5 minutes
Self Service
• Credit card over the web in many
countries – or through your IBM rep
IBM Bluemix Barcelona MeetupPróxima quedada 1 de julio…
Apúntate en: http://www.meetup.com/Bluemix-Barcelona/